Archer Aviation Inc. (NYSE:ACHR – Get Free Report) insider Eric Lentell sold 3,754 shares of Archer Aviation stock in a transaction on Thursday, June 11th. The shares were sold at an average price of $5.00, for a total transaction of $18,770.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the insider directly owned 137,330 shares in the company, valued at $686,650. The trade was a 2.66%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at this link. The sale was made to cover tax withholding obligations related to the vesting of equity awards.
Eric Lentell also recently made the following trade(s):
- On Monday, May 18th, Eric Lentell sold 48,169 shares of Archer Aviation stock. The stock was sold at an average price of $5.95, for a total transaction of $286,605.55.
- On Friday, May 15th, Eric Lentell sold 39,967 shares of Archer Aviation stock. The stock was sold at an average price of $6.06, for a total transaction of $242,200.02.

About Archer Aviation
Archer Aviation, Inc (NYSE: ACHR) is a California-based aerospace company developing electric vertical takeoff and landing (eVTOL) aircraft designed to serve as sustainable urban air mobility solutions. Founded in 2018 by Adam Goldstein and Brett Adcock, Archer focuses on the design, development and certification of zero-emissions air taxis aimed at reducing traffic congestion in densely populated metropolitan areas. The company’s flagship prototypes, “Maker” and “Midnight,” have been engineered to deliver quiet, efficient short-haul flights with ranges of up to 100 miles per charge.
Headquartered in Palo Alto, California, Archer operates a manufacturing facility in nearby Santa Cruz County and maintains research partnerships with automotive and energy companies, including a collaboration with Stellantis to integrate advanced battery systems.
